Gita Press English

Struck with terror (continues Lord Ýiva) the monkeys turned tail, although UmŒ, they would come out victorious in the end. One exclaimed, “Where are A˘gada and HanumŒn? Where are the mighty Nala, N¶la and Dvivida?” At the time HanumŒn heard that his troops were breaking, that mighty warrior held his position at the western gate of La˘kŒ, where MeghanŒda led the defence. The gate, however, would not give way and HanumŒn was faced with a mighty impediment. The son of the wind-god grew terribly furious at heart and the warrior, who was formidable as death, gave a loud roar. He sprang and reached the fort of La˘kŒ; and seizing a rock he rushed at MeghanŒda, shattered his chariot, overthrew the charioteer and kicked MeghanŒda himself at his chest. Another charioteer, who perceived the distress of the prince, picked him up in his own chariot and speedily brought him home. (1—4)
